Namecoin (NMC), despite being one of the oldest and more recognized coins in crypto, is currently ranked coin #252 by market cap. This begs the question... Is Namecoin the most undervalued altcoin? Why or why not? Pros - 1st Altcoin Created
- 2nd Highest Network Hashrate
- Solves Centralization Issues With Current Internet DNS Framework
Trading - 25 Million Dollar Market Cap (ranked #252)
- $350,000 24-Hour Volume
- Absent on all Top 30 Exchanges by 24-Hour Volume

Hi personal post here.
I'm a small home miner and wanted to increase capacity and not have neighbors kill me. So exhausting through garage wall directly isn't an option. I have decent removal but want add more units and will need to increase exhausting. Been looking at whole house fans to install above miners but the cost is pretty high. These look simple to construct from high CFM gable fan, ceiling register with flex duct, and of course mounting braces from rafters. Should be able to save quite a bit with DYI, just want to make sure I'm not missing any critical differences from a pre-constructed whole house fan to building one as described. Thanks.
The main piece of advice I can give is to be aware of where you'll be taking air in. For all the air you exhaust, you will intake the same amount somewhere.

My experience in avoiding the scams project is: 1. Evaluate team members and project advisors whether they are real people. Because there are projects to get the information of celebrities to trick people. 2. Analysis of white papers and roadmap to evaluate the idea of the project is realistic and potential long-term development in the future.
Evaluation of the team members and those advertising the project is key. With more than 85% of ICOs being nothing more than confidence scams, knowing the people behind it is the single most important factor. Most good projects these days are able to secure funding, or do not need funding, leaving the ICO market as a breeding ground for get rich quick scammers. The only people who benefit from these pump and dump schemes are the users behind it and their army of alts, who typically pay themselves in the form of signature campaigns.
